Cook, Michael; Ross, Steven M. – Center for Research and Reform in Education, 2022
The purpose of this evaluation was to examine the impact of i-Ready Personalized Instruction that met Curriculum Associates' recommended usage levels on mathematics achievement, as measured by the Massachusetts Comprehensive Assessment System (MCAS) mathematics assessment. Aru, Sidika Akyüz; Kale, Mustafa – Journal of Education and Training Studies, 2019
The overall aim of this study is to investigate the effect of school-related factors and early learning experiences on mathematics achievement. In this causal-comparative research, HLM analysis was performed on the data of 6378 students, their parents, and 241 school principals and primary school teachers. Liu, Ru-De; Ding, Yi; Xu, Le; Wang, Jia – Journal of Educational Research, 2017
The authors' aim was to examine the relation between two-digit mental multiplication and working memory. In Study 1, involving 30 fifth-grade students, we used digit span backward as an abbreviated measure of working memory.
